The circumference of the base of a cylinder open at the top is 132 cm. The sum of radius and height is 41 cm. Find the cost of polishing the outer surface area of the cylinder at the rate of Rs. 10 per square decimeter.

Concept Used: Circumference of the base of the cylinder = 2πr


Outer Surface Area of cylinder = 2πrh


Where r = radius of the cylinder and h = height of the cylinder.


Given: r + h = 41 cm


Circumference of the base of cylinder = 2πr = 132 cm


Explanation:


Let us calculate the value of “r” first,


2πr = 132 cm




r = (3 × 7) cm


r = 21 cm.


Now, let us calculate the height of the cylinder,


r + h = 41


Putting the obtained value of “r” we get,


21 + h = 41


h = 20 cm


Now putting the values of “r” and “h” in the formula of Outer Surface Area of the cylinder we get,
